CVE-2026-40253:
openCryptoki is a PKCS#11 library and provides tooling for Linux and AIX. In versions 3.26.0 and below,
the BER/DER decoding functions in the shared common library (asn1.c) accept a raw pointer but no buffer
length parameter, and trust attacker-controlled BER length fields without validating them against actual
buffer boundaries. All primitive decoders are affected: ber_decode_INTEGER, ber_decode_SEQUENCE,
ber_decode_OCTET_STRING, ber_decode_BIT_STRING, and ber_decode_CHOICE. Additionally, ber_decode_INTEGER
can produce integer underflows when the encoded length is zero. An attacker supplying a malformed BER-
encoded cryptographic object through PKCS#11 operations such as C_CreateObject or C_UnwrapKey, token
loading from disk, or remote backend communication can trigger out-of-bounds reads. This affects all token
backends (Soft, ICA, CCA, TPM, EP11, ICSF) since the vulnerable code is in the shared common library. A
patch is available thorugh commit ed378f463ef73364c89feb0fc923f4dc867332a3.
